Lynsay and Gage, a great couple, a multiple friend and family story. Gage has his mother and younger brother at home, and the small town of Buffalo Valley has lost it's school teacher. So, Lynsay as she travels with her friend Maddie goes on vacation to her old family town, where her father grew up. She meets new people and decides to move to Buffalo Valley and live there for at least 1 year and teach school. Lynsay and Gage argue about a lot of things, but finally their relationship gets off the ground. Love is so deep that it is hard to not share it. Some of the other people in the story like Buffalo Bob Carr and his Buffalo Gal, Merry finally will get together thruout the series of books. Plus a multitude of others. Real life, with family icons like Grampa Joshua and the lady who runs the pharmacy who has helped and guided the town of Buffalo Valley for all of her years.
